I. The Medical Situation in Xi’an
(1) Abundant and High-quality Medical Resources
Xi’an has established a complete and high-quality medical system. Various medical institutions are scattered throughout the city, comprehensively safeguarding the health of the public and foreign patients. As of 2023, there were 7,713 medical and health institutions of various types in the whole city, among which there were 395 hospitals. These include various types such as general hospitals, specialized hospitals, and primary medical units, with a rich variety of disciplines, which can meet the diverse medical needs of different patients. The First Affiliated Hospital of Xi’an Jiaotong University, as a leader in regional medical care, is a comprehensive hospital integrating medical treatment, teaching, scientific research, prevention, and health care. It has achieved remarkable results in disciplines such as cardiovascular medicine, general surgery, and neurology. Equipped with advanced medical equipment and a highly professional medical team, it has attracted many domestic and foreign patients.

(2) International Medical Services
In order to create a convenient and comfortable medical environment for foreign patients, medical institutions in Xi’an are actively integrating with international standards and optimizing services from multiple dimensions. Many large hospitals have established international medical departments, fully considering the needs of foreign patients in aspects such as the medical treatment process and cultural care. Take the International Medical Department of Shaanxi Provincial People’s Hospital as an example. Here, a group of medical staff proficient in multiple languages such as English and Japanese have gathered to ensure smooth communication with foreign patients. The internal signs of the hospital use both Chinese and English, clearly guiding patients to the registration office, consulting rooms, examination rooms, pharmacies, and other areas. During the diagnosis and treatment process, medical staff will patiently and meticulously explain the diagnosis of the illness, treatment plan, and rehabilitation precautions to patients in a foreign language, respecting the religious beliefs, cultural customs, and lifestyles of patients from different countries, so that foreign patients can feel the warmth and care like home in a foreign land.

(4) Medical Insurance
When foreign patients seek medical treatment in Xi’an, it is crucial to understand information related to medical insurance. Considering that the fees for some medical service items are relatively high, purchasing suitable medical insurance has become the key to reducing the economic burden. International hospitals and special needs wards in public hospitals usually charge relatively high fees, and some insurance companies classify them as “high-cost” medical institutions. Therefore, patients may need to purchase insurance products with higher premiums to achieve full coverage of all expenses, or bear the self-paid expenses according to a certain proportion. Some insurance policies only cover hospitalization treatment expenses. The premiums of such insurance are relatively low, but patients need to bear the expenses for outpatient consultations, examinations, etc. by themselves. If patients have a limited budget, they can consider choosing the general outpatient services of public hospitals, which are more affordable. While those health insurance policies that cover outpatient services (such as doctor consultations, dental treatments, drug expenses, etc.), although the premiums are higher, can fully meet the medical needs of patients in international hospitals and clinics, providing comprehensive medical insurance for patients.

(5) Medical Emergency Rescue
Xi’an has established an efficient and complete medical emergency rescue system to ensure that patients can quickly receive professional assistance in case of emergencies. The medical emergency call in Xi’an is 120. The Xi’an Emergency Center has advanced emergency equipment and an experienced and responsive emergency team, which can respond to all kinds of emergency medical needs in the first place, quickly reach the scene and carry out rescue operations. In addition, some international hospitals and clinics in Xi’an also have 24-hour emergency hotlines, making it convenient for patients to seek help in case of sudden emergencies. When foreign patients first arrive in Xi’an, it is strongly recommended that they understand and remember these emergency rescue information in advance, and at the same time, be familiar with the geographical location of surrounding hospitals, so that they can quickly and accurately obtain medical assistance at critical moments to ensure their own health and safety.

II. The Tourism Situation in Xi’an
(1) Rich Historical and Cultural Scenic Spots
1. Terracotta Army: The Terracotta Army, namely the Terracotta Warriors and Horses of Emperor Qinshihuang’s Mausoleum, is also simply referred to as the Qin Terracotta Warriors or Qin Terracotta Figures. It is the largest group of terra-cotta figures in China and a rare art treasure in the world, known as the “Eighth Wonder of the World.” The Terracotta Army is located in the pits of the Terracotta Warriors and Horses, 1.5 kilometers east of Emperor Qinshihuang’s Mausoleum in Lintong District, Xi’an City, Shaanxi Province. A large number of terra-cotta figures and horses similar in size to real people and horses are buried here. They are neatly arranged, with a magnificent momentum, vividly showing the powerful military force and superb sculpting art of the Qin Dynasty. Tourists can admire the exquisite terra-cotta figures here, learn about the history and culture of the Qin Dynasty, and feel the profoundness of history.

2. City Wall of Xi’an: The City Wall of Xi’an is located in the central area of Xi’an City, Shaanxi Province. It is one of the largest and best-preserved ancient city walls in China. The existing city wall is a Ming Dynasty building, with a total length of 13.7 kilometers. It was built in the third year of the Hongwu period of Emperor Taizu of the Ming Dynasty (1370 AD) and completed in the eleventh year of the Hongwu period (1378 AD). It was built on the basis of the imperial city of the Sui and Tang dynasties and was the prefectural city of Xi’an at that time. It was repeatedly repaired and expanded during the Ming and Qing dynasties. Standing on the ancient city wall, tourists can overlook the scenery of Xi’an urban area and feel the charm of the ancient city. On the city wall, tourists can also rent bicycles and ride along the wall to enjoy the scenery along the way.

3. Giant Wild Goose Pagoda: The Giant Wild Goose Pagoda is located in the Daci’en Temple in Jinchangfang of the ancient Chang’an City (now south of Xi’an City, Shaanxi Province), also known as the “Pagoda of Daci’en Temple.” It was built to preserve the Buddhist scriptures and statues brought back to Chang’an by Master Xuanzang from India via the Silk Road. The Giant Wild Goose Pagoda is 64.517 meters high in total, with a bottom side length of 25.5 meters. Its shape is simple and unsophisticated, with a magnificent momentum. A large number of Buddhist cultural relics and historical documents are collected in the pagoda, which have extremely high historical value and artistic value. Tourists can climb up the Giant Wild Goose Pagoda, admire the surrounding scenery, and feel the profoundness of Buddhist culture.

(4) Culinary Experiences
The cuisine in Xi’an is unique, diverse, and mouth-watering.
1. Pita Bread Soaked in Lamb Soup: Pita Bread Soaked in Lamb Soup is a traditional famous snack in Xi’an, known for its rich soup flavor and tender meat. When making it, first break the pita bread into small pieces, then add cooked mutton and beef, vermicelli, wood ear, and other ingredients, pour on the boiling mutton soup, and sprinkle with scallions, coriander, and other seasonings. When eating, put the pita bread and meat into the mouth together, with a mellow taste and endless aftertaste.

2. Chinese Hamburger: Chinese Hamburger is one of the characteristic delicacies in Xi’an, loved by people for its crispy outer skin and tender meat filling. The outer skin of the pita bread for the Chinese Hamburger is crispy, and the inside is soft. The meat filling is made of pork with a proper proportion of fat and lean, which has a strong aroma after being braised in a sauce. Chop the braised meat and put it between the pita bread, and take a bite, the meat aroma overflows.

3. Other Special Delicacies: In addition to Pita Bread Soaked in Lamb Soup and Chinese Hamburger, Xi’an also has many other special delicacies. For example, Cold Noodles are very popular for their smooth taste and sour and spicy flavor; Biangbiang Noodles are wide, thick, and chewy, paired with meat sauce, vegetables, and other seasonings, with a rich taste; Zeng Cake is mainly made of glutinous rice and red dates, and after being steamed, it has a soft and glutinous taste, sweet and delicious. Tourists can taste a variety of characteristic Xi’an snacks at one stop in food blocks such as the Muslim Quarter and Yongxingfang, and feel the charm of Xi’an’s food culture.

(5) Convenient Transportation and Tourism Services
1. Convenient Transportation: Xi’an has a convenient transportation network, providing great convenience for tourists’ travel. In terms of urban transportation, subways, buses, taxis, and other means of transportation are all available. Subway lines cover the main areas of the city, making it convenient for tourists to reach various scenic spots. For example, taking Subway Line 1 can directly reach scenic spots such as the City Wall of Xi’an and the Muslim Quarter; taking Subway Line 3 can reach places such as the Giant Wild Goose Pagoda and the Grand Tang Mall. In addition, there are shared bicycles in Xi’an, which are convenient for tourists’ short-distance travel. In terms of external transportation, Xi’an Xianyang International Airport is one of the important aviation hubs in China, with frequent flights to and from many cities at home and abroad; Xi’an’s railway transportation is also very developed, with multiple high-speed rail lines leading to all parts of the country, making it convenient for tourists to come to Xi’an for tourism.
